Knights, kings, and chess champs

91原创 Open chess tourney attracts more than eighty people to Brookswood Seniors Centre

Though not known to be much of a spectator鈥檚 sport, the 91原创 Open chess tournament was labeled 鈥渧ery intense鈥 by 91原创 Chess Club member and secretary, Brian Davidson.

鈥淓ach game runs three to four hours long 鈥 one in the morning and one in the afternoon,鈥 Davidson explained. 鈥淭hey鈥檙e long days.鈥

The annual 91原创 Open was held over the Labour Day long weekend at Brookswood Seniors Centre, attracting 83 players 鈥 a record high with age ranges representing nearly a century鈥檚 worth of chess enthusiasts.

鈥淭he oldest player we had would have been in their eighties while the youngest would have been six or seven,鈥 Davidson said. 鈥淚t鈥檚 really good to see kids there 鈥 they鈥檙e very strong. Many come from Vancouver Chess School鈥ou鈥檇 be surprised how good they are.鈥

Neil Doknjas, a 14-year-old club member and 91原创 Open participant has competed in tournaments all around the globe including the World Youth Chess Championships in both Greece and Slovenia.

Doknjas earned the second highest score of the tournament, which awarded him a spot in the next provincial level.

鈥淚t鈥檚 always fun to play chess no matter how intense a tournament gets. I enjoy the competitive aspects as well as the use of strategy.鈥 Doknjas said. 鈥淐hess helps to develop good decision making and the ability to calculate or plan. A good work ethic is important in order to be successful.鈥

Davaa-Ochir Nyamdorj, a 23-year-old accomplished chess player came in first place, winning every match he played and beating Doknjas in the final round.

Both will now take part in the 104th B.C. Closed championship in New Westminster, Oct. 11 to 14 for a shot at the provincial chess title.

Doknjas鈥 entire family also lives and breathes the game 鈥 older brothers John and Joshua co-authored the chess book, Opening Repertoire: The Sicilian Najdorf, and have earned the top title at the 91原创 Open in previous years too.

鈥淭he B.C. Closed is on the Thanksgiving long weekend and is an eight player round robin,鈥 Doknjas explained, who will also be competing against brother Joshua. 鈥淭o prepare, I will solve chess puzzles and simply play practice games with Joshua and John.鈥

Davidson said this tourney is one of the final and largest qualifiers for the B.C. Closed tournament, which the 91原创 Chess Club has hosted for the past 15 years.

Doknjas won the 91原创 Chess Club Championship outright in 2014 and has taught lessons in and outside the community ever since.

The is one of the oldest continuing clubs in Lower Mainland, operating for well over forty years.

Members meet Mondays, 7 p.m. at Brookswood Seniors Centre, 19899 36 Ave. New members are welcome.
